Reduces condensation

Double glazing is an excellent method to reduce energy consumption however it can cause condensation. Mold can develop when moisture inside the window panes is held in. This could cause serious health problems for your family and you It is therefore essential to eliminate the condensation as quickly as you can. To accomplish this you can use a hairdryer to dry the windows. This is a temporary fix. The best method to get rid of the condensation is to replace the double glazing.

It's important that you employ a professional to repair the misty glass window. This is because it's not a good idea to try to repair the window yourself. You could seriously harm yourself or cause damage to the structure of your home. You might not have the right tools for the task. A professional glazier is equipped with the tools and experience necessary to handle your windows in a safe manner.

Certain condensations in double glazing could be caused by a defect in the sealant. This can happen when the sealant used is of poor quality or was incorrectly applied at the factory. In this situation the inert gases contained in the double-glazed glass will disappear. The window will then turn translucent, and its energy efficiency will decrease.

A glazier will be capable of resolving this issue by replacing the entire double glazed glass unit. The glazier will first remove any moisture from the window. Then, he will clean the glass surface before sealing the window. It is possible to replace the frame or sash depending on the type of glass. In most instances replacement of the window will not cost as much as repairing the damaged seal.

A Glazier will also make sure that the air gap between the windows is properly sealed. To do this, the glazier will drill an insignificant hole through the glass and then spray cleaning solution into the gap. He will then wait for the moisture to dry completely. Once the moisture is gone, the glazier applies an anti-fog and vents the window.

There are many reasons why you might have to replace a pane of window glass, from massive scratches and chips to condensation between the two panes. It's best to have the damaged pane replaced with a clean, heat-retaining glass unit known as an IGU (insulated glass unit). The installer will take off and clean the damaged window. Then, they will install and seal the IGU. They will also weather strip and caulk the window to ensure it is sealed properly.

Over time the seals between glass panes in a double-glazed window may be damaged. This could lead to condensation and mist. If this happens, you might be able to repair the seal, instead of replacing the whole window. This is often cheaper and quicker, and could save you a considerable amount of money in the long run.

It's worth upgrading to toughened glass when replacing a double-glazed window. It's five times stronger and more resistant to impacts and shattering than standard laminated. This kind of glass will typically be more expensive than laminated standard glass, but it's a safe option for your family's safety and security.
